Senior/ Principal Electromechanical Technologist, Data Acquisition - Onsite
Sandia National Laboratories is the nation’s premier science and engineering lab for national security and technology innovation. They are seeking a skilled Electromechanical Technologist to design, implement, and maintain data acquisition and control systems, ensuring operational reliability and efficiency while collaborating with cross-functional teams to address technical challenges.
GovernmentInformation TechnologyNational Security
Responsibilities
Provide designs, controls, and engineering support for data acquisition and control systems
Conduct testing and oversight of existing data acquisition and control systems
Maintain data acquisition and control systems software and hardware
Implement software data analytics routines into programs for non-technical operators
Assist with the implementation and commissioning of contractor-supplied software into current and future operations control and data acquisition systems
Troubleshoot problems and implement workable solutions as required
Qualification
Required
High school diploma or higher degree plus three (3) or more years of related experience
Experience in operating and set up of oscilloscopes and soldering and/or standard electrical engineering measurement and test equipment such as power meters/sensors, and signal/waveform generators
Able to obtain and maintain a DOE Q-level security clearance
